Flybe capital raise takes off to land new fleet
Flybe has launched a share sale that it hopes will pull in up to £150m to invest in its own fleet of planes. The UK airline is shifting its approach so that it owns its planes, rather than leases them. It hopes the sale of up to 141.5m new ordinary shares will help to finance this restructuring.
